the current dictionary has basic data and its good and simple.
## Request 1
However, if we can implement a `tag` field then that would be awesome. That will be useful, as we can then be able to say which device uploaded the code. The each device should be able to do that GET/POST request
Example
```
{"type":"text","data":"clipboard", "tag":"windows11"}
```
## Request 2
midgard is very useful when copying links from one device to another. If there is an ability to apply regex on the fly to the copied content such that the output of regex is then passed to the `data` field then that would be awesome.
We could have a separate file like `regex.txt` where we can store the different regex and the associated data that will result with that
Example:
```
{"type":"text","data":"example.com", "original": "https://example.com", "tag":"iphone", ""}
```
`regex.txt`
```
if the text if from tag "iphone" and "windows11" then apply the following regex
^(https:)(?=.*example\.com)
```
